Les Modèles “Meilleur Moyen De Supprimer” Ne Correspondaient Pas Nécessairement à L’erreur De Recherche

Les Modèles “Meilleur Moyen De Supprimer” Ne Correspondaient Pas Nécessairement à L’erreur De Recherche

Au cours des dernières semaines, certains de nos utilisateurs ont rencontré une erreur à un endroit où une chaîne ne correspondait pas à une erreur de recherche. Cette situation peut survenir pour plusieurs raisons. Discutons-en ci-dessous.

Votre ordinateur fonctionne-t-il lentement, plante-t-il fréquemment ou ne fonctionne-t-il pas aussi bien ? Alors vous avez besoin de Reimage!

C’est en fait parce que vous utilisez la configuration de basculement de la tâche de recherche “Erreur de composant”. l’élément échouera si une incompatibilité ridicule se produit. Vous devez le remplacer avec succès par “Redirect string” et il s’ensuit que vous utilisez la sortie d’erreur de la tâche pour envoyer ces chaînes où vous le souhaitez.

Publié pour la première fois sur MSDN le 13 mars 2013.

Gens,
Récemment, j’ai eu à pratiquer beaucoup lié aux processus de stockage de données. Je suis donc tombé sur un bogue dans la cible de transformation de recherche SSIS que je souhaite partager. La plupart de mes tâches de groupe se sont bien déroulées jusqu’à ce que l’erreur d’application se produise dans la recherche après avoir trouvé un million de lignes.

Ensuite, j’ai réalisé que le comportement lié à l’exploration par défaut échouait si vous ne trouviez pas de correspondance. Cela se produit sûrement parce que j’ai utilisé la configuration de frustration de la tâche de recherche “Fail Component” de brique et de mortier ; il échouera si une incompatibilité se produit. J’ai dû changer ce spécifique en “chaîne de redirection”, puis inclure la tâche d’erreur youvod pour placer la plupart de ces lignes là où je voulais. Ainsi, pendant que vous définissez la nouvelle recherche sur “redirection d’erreur”, au lieu de simplement ne pas voir la tâche (l’erreur que j’ai eue), quelques lignes incompatibles peuvent être envoyées à votre sortie d’erreur valide. Évidemment, ces lignes d’erreur finissent par être nulles dans les colonnes ajoutées et également par chaque transformation Lookup. Ensuite, ce qu’il faut faire de ces erreurs peut être décidé directement en fonction des conditions préalables. Par exemple, pour un magasin de données uniquement, vous pouvez remplacer les valeurs nulles en tenant compte des valeurs par défaut et les insérer dans l’ensemble de la table cible. et/ou vous pourrez les inclure dans le tableau des erreurs d’achat. Voici les détails que j’ai pris :

— Nous avons changé la propriété de la tâche de recherche exacte en “Redirect guitar strings to error output”.

la ligne a donné une correspondance absolue lors de l'erreur de recherche

The Line “Best Way To Delete” Did Not Match The Search Error
La Riga “Il Modo Migliore Per Eliminare” Non Corrispondeva All’errore Di Ricerca
La Línea “La Mejor Manera De Eliminar” No Coincide Con El Error De Búsqueda
Строка “Лучший способ удаления” не соответствовала ошибке поиска
Wiersz „Najlepszy Sposób Usunięcia” Nie Pasuje Do Błędu Wyszukiwania
De Regel “Beste Manier Om Te Verwijderen” Kwam Niet Overeen Met De Zoekfout
“가장 좋은 삭제 방법” 행이 검색 오류와 일치하지 않습니다.
Raden “Bästa Sättet Att Ta Bort” Matchade Inte Sökfelet
A Linha “Melhor Maneira De Excluir” Não Correspondeu Ao Erro De Pesquisa
Die Zeile „Best Way To Delete“ Stimmte Nicht Mit Dem Suchfehler überein